Archive for June 29th, 2010

Definitions of Japanese tax, legal and other terms

A well known landmark in a passageway under Shinjuku Station

When interpreting tax matters it is critical to have a proper understanding of the terms used in Japanese legislation, accounting standards or similar technical documents. In order to help users of the Japan Tax Site get such an understanding the Site has developed a searchable database (the ‘Tax Definitions Database‘) of translations and explanations of Japanese technical terms Read More